WitrynaFTA certifications are optional, and not required for shipments to clear customs. However, goods shipped without one may be assessed standard tariff rate, so be sure to include an FTA certification of origin. For shipments below $2,500, the exporter should indicate on an invoice that a product is of U.S. origin and qualifies for an FTA. Annual blanket certifications are permitted Certification is required* for: Shipments to Canada valued at greater than CAD $3,300 Shipments to Mexico valued at greater than USD … Witryna1 lip 2024 · No1 indicates that you have knowledge that the goods are originating. But, just because you believe it that doesn’t make it true, so customs authorities usually consider No1 to be an invalid answer. No2 means you have in writing from the producer that the goods qualify as originating. fish oil supplements prostate cancer https://accweb.net

WitrynaRules of origin (ROOs) are listed in FTA agreements by HS product classification numbers: Australia, NAFTA, Chile, Colombia, CAFTA-DR, Korea, Singapore, Peru, and Panama. Other ROOs are based on a 35% appraised value method: Israel, Jordan, Bahrain, Morocco, and Oman.
